How to check/count Back Links

I wrote about How to Create Back Links previously.

Now let's see how to check for back links. This is useful for blogs, websites, etc.

On the Google search bar simply type
link:

For example
link:thingswelovetohate.blogspot.com
or
link:http://thingswelovetohate.blogspot.com

would result to the same number of back links.

You can determine how many back links a website has on the same window. Right above the search results, and right below the Search text box is a blue (in classic mode) highlighted line that shows how many results were found.

The following can be done for free:

1. Submit your site to Yahoo.

2. Answer forum questions through links to your site: so make sure you post the answer FIRST before giving the link, and provide the link to the actual blog entry so that it can still be accessible to other people who are browsing for answers to the same question.

The following are good sites where you can go and answer other people's questions:

1. Yahoo! Answers

2. MyLot

5. Make sure you put your blog link in your email signature, forum signature. And update your social networking accounts and put your blog link on the MyWebsite area.

6. Post a bulletin on Friendster, MySpace, Facebook, Plurk and other social networking sites that you belong to and invite them to take a look at your blog. You may also do this for blog entries that may interest such audience.

7. Ping your site every time you post a new entry. This may be tiresome but it's worth it - while you're at it, make sure your blog posts have tags because Ping sites such as Technorati utilize blog entry tags.
